In recent years, collagen supplements have become quite popular—and for good reason. Collagen, which is the most abundant protein in your body, has a number of key functions for your body. Here you’ll find the science-backed health benefits that come with taking collagen.

Collagen can improve skin health 

As you age, your body produces less collagen, leading to dry skin and the formation of wrinkles. With collagen, you can slow the gaining of your skin as the protein benefits elasticity and hydration, helping you to ward off wrinkles.

It helps relieve joint pain

Collagen helps maintain the integrity of your cartilage, which is the rubber-like tissue that protects your joints. As the amount of collagen in your body decreases as you get older, your risk of developing degenerative joint disorders such as osteoarthritis increases. Some studies have shown that taking collagen supplements may help improve symptoms of osteoarthritis and reduce joint pain overall. Researchers have theorized that supplemental collagen may accumulate in cartilage and stimulate your tissues to make collagen. They have suggested this may lead to lower inflammation, better support of your joints, and reduced pain.

Collagen could prevent bone loss

Just as the collagen in your body deteriorates as you age, so does bone mass. Studies have shown that taking collagen supplements may have certain effects on the body that help inhibit the bone breakdown that leads to osteoporosis.

Collagen boosts muscle mass

Between 1–10% of muscle tissue is composed of collagen. Studies suggest that collagen supplements help boost muscle mass in people with sarcopenia, the loss of muscle mass that happens with age.

Promotes heart health

Collagen provides structure to your arteries, which are the blood vessels that carry blood from your heart to the rest of your body. Without enough collagen, arteries may become weak and fragile.
